Kurt Ritter to head Rezidor until 2012
Rezidor's group's president and chief executive Kurt Ritter has announced he will continue to head the hotel company until February 2012.
Ritter has been at the helm of Rezidor for 32 years, including 19 years as the president and chief executive.
Under his leadership, Rezidor has developed five brands and almost 350 hotels with more than 74,000 rooms in operation and under development in 53 countries across Europe, the Middle East and Africa.
Urban Jansson, chairman of the board of directors of Rezidor said: "This decision will further fortify and ensure the continuity of a strong leadership under which Rezidor has delivered an unparalleled growth.
"Kurt is probably the longest serving chief executive within the industry and we are proud of his achievements and happy to be able to further count on his experience, knowledge and long term view on the business for another three years."
The company plans to focus its expansion on markets in Russia and the Eastern Bloc, Africa and the Middle East. It is also continuing to look out for management and franchise contracts.
